Key Responsibilities
  • Evaluate assigned patients and develop, implement, and modify individualized treatment plans in accordance with patient needs, goals, and physician direction.
  • Delegate and direct discipline-specific therapy services for assigned patients, ensuring functional treatment programs support effective return to community activities.
  • Complete thorough medical record documentation in a clear, concise, and timely manner, including goal writing, functional quality indicator assessments, letters of medical necessity, and charge entry in compliance with state, federal, and intermediary guidelines.
  • Ensure all care is provided under signed, valid physician orders and within insurance approvals as required for patient care.
  • Participate in student programs as assigned, providing appropriate supervision, developing learning objectives, and completing student evaluations.
  • Adhere to discipline-specific State Practice Act and all applicable regulatory requirements, maintaining professional licensure in good standing.
Required Qualifications
  • Active and unrestricted Physical Therapist license in the state of New Hampshire.
  • Ability to complete comprehensive patient evaluations and develop evidence-based treatment plans with appropriate discharge goals.
  • Proficiency in medical record documentation in compliance with state, federal, and payer guidelines.
  • Commitment to patient and employee safety standards, including safe patient handling and infection control practices.
  • Adherence to discipline-specific professional code of conduct and ethical standards.
